1、CDN加速原理是就近原则 也就是用户访问会自动访问CDN离用户最近的节点上。理论上是可以提升用户访问速度的。目前国内各大CDN很少有支持防护攻击的,因为节点如果装硬防的话 成本是很高的,一个CDN服务商起码几百个节点,都是高防的话成本贵得飞起。
2、CDN加速的原理是什么?CDN加速技术就是在用户和服务器之间增加镜像缓存(Cache)层,将用户的访问请求引导到镜像缓存(Cache)节点而不是服务器源站点,要实现这目的,主要是通过接管DNS实现,下面图示便可看出传统网站访问过程与使用CDN加速技术后的网站访问过程之间的区别所在。
3、CDN加速的原理 CDN加速的核心原理是“就近访问”,即在用户请求网站资源时,CDN会将资源缓存在距离用户最近的节点上,从而提高访问速度。当用户请求资源时,CDN会自动根据用户的物理位置,将资源从离用户最近的节点上调取。
前台技术视频网站的前台技术主要包括: 视频网站,JAVA或PHP构建; 社区或社交; Flash播放器及其他客户端。
流媒体类业务一般是服务器—客户端或客户端—客户端的业务服务架构,视音频编解码是服务器和客户端的重要功能之一,视音频编解码需要耗费大量的服务器/客户端软件和硬件资源,因此目前的服务器或客户端难以承受大的并发服务/业务请求,一般服务器只能支持1000以内的并发影视媒体流访问。
SHE-VHO-VSO模型——这种架构是一种层级架构:“超级头端”(SHE)汇集大范围内或全国的内容并且在大范围内提供实时全国内容,通常采用IP作为网络层协议。“视频中心局”(VHO)与SHE一起把本地与区域内容整合到内容组合中,从而确保全国与本地内容的供应。
网络直播平台的实现技术,归纳起来主要有如下这些:视音频的采集和编码技术,当前主流的主要是H.26H.265这种视频编码技术和AAC、MP3这种音频编码技术。视音频的流媒体传输技术。CDN内容分发技术。终端解码技术。
短视频所面临的架构问题:短视频APP开发时的数据处理需求 客户端主要是对于视频的效果叠加、人脸识别和各种美颜美化算法的处理。同时客户端处理还会增加一些必要的转码和水印的视频处理。
1、CDN(Content Delivery Network,内容分发网络)是指由分布在各地的服务器所组成的网络,能够更加快速地将内容分发到全球各地用户的电脑上。在这个网络上,每个服务器都是一个节点,负责存储和传输用户需要的数据。
2、CDN,全称内容分发网络(ContentDeliveryNetwork),可以简单地将其理解成一个离你很近的、可以从上面获取到完整的原始数据的服务器,它会定期和拥有原始内容的服务器进行同步,保证用户可以从上面获取到最新的内容。
3、CDN(Content Delivery Network)是指内容分发网络,也称为内容传送网络,这个概念始于1996年,是美国麻省理工学院的一个研究小组为改善互联网的服务质量而提出的。
4、cdn英文全称是Content Delivery Network,翻译为中文就是内容分发网络。cdn服务器是指拥有cdn功能的服务器,使用CDN服务器访问网络会在Internet中重新构架一个新的网络架构,并启用特殊的网络发送功能给用户的网络。
5、CDN指的是Content Delivery Network,即内容分发网络。CDN由初始服务器、分布在边缘的缓存服务器、重定向DNS服务器和内容交换服务器组成。
直播工作原理的基石直播数据的进出通道实时转码的魔力直播流的输出与CDN的力量直播的工作原理与视频文件转码在本质上是相似的,但直播需要在数据的接收和发送端进行特殊处理。直播系统的核心是视频转码程序,它从流媒体服务获取直播源数据,处理后再推送给用户。
在直播的世界中,两个核心术语——推流与拉流,犹如舞台上的指挥棒,驱动着复杂业务流程的运作。拉流,如同观众进入剧场,是直播体验的“最后一公里”,任何微小问题都可能放大影响。从业者的目光聚焦在优化这一关键环节,以提升观看者的满意度。
数据流转的桥梁/: 从采集、编码,通过流媒体服务器进行数据传输,再到解码并显示,这个过程涉及复杂的网络传输和编码技术(流媒体服务器通常使用第三方服务/)。内容分发的挑战/: CDN(内容分发网络)是直播中的关键,它负责将主播视频快速送达各地。
1、CDN,全称Content Delivery Network,即内容分发网络。CDN是在现有Internet基础上增加一层新的网络架构,通过部署边缘服务器,采用负载均衡 、内容分发、调度等功能,使用户可以就近访问获取所需内容,从而解决网站堵塞情况,提高用户访问响应速度。
2、CDN的全称是Content Delivery Network,即内容分发网络。CDN的基本原理是广泛采用各种缓存服务器,将这些缓存服务器分布到用户访问相对集中的地区或网络中,在用户访问网站时,利用全局负载技术将用户的访问指向距离最近的工作正常的缓存服务器上,由缓存服务器直接响应用户请求。
3、CDN的全称是Content Delivery Network,即内容分发网络。内容分发网络就像前面提到的全国仓配网络一样,解决了因分布、带宽、服务器性能带来的访问延迟问题,适用于站点加速、点播、直播等场景。使用户可就近取得所需内容,解决 Internet网络拥挤的状况,提高用户访问网站的响应速度和成功率。
4、CDN指的是内容分发网络。CDN是指一种透过互联网互相连接的电脑网络系统,利用最靠近每位用户的服务器,更快、更可靠地将音乐、图片、视频、应用程序及其他文件发送给用户,来提供高性能、可扩展性及低成本的网络内容传递给用户。内容分发网络节点会在多个地点,多个不同的网络上摆放。
5、CDN的全称是Content Delivery Network,即内容分发网络。传统CDN是通过在网络各处放置节点服务器所构成的在现有的互联网基础之上的一层智能虚拟网络,CDN系统能够实时地根据网络流量和各节点的连接、负载状况以及到用户的距离和响应时间等综合信息将用户的请求重新导向离用户最近的服务节点上。
实际上,内容分发布网络(CDN)是一种新型的网络构建方式,它是为能在传统的IP网发布宽带丰富媒体而特别优化的网络覆盖层;而从广义的角度,CDN代表了一种基于质量与秩序的网络服务模式。
CDN即内容分发网络,加速的意思,那么网站CND服务就是网站加速服务。
什么是CDN服务啊?CDN,即内容分发网络,通俗讲其主要功能就是让在各个不同地点的网络用户,都能够快速访问到网站提供的内容,不会经常出现等待或是卡顿的状况。CDN,简单来讲就是一项非常有效的缩短时延的技术,CDN这个技术其实说起来并不复杂,最初的核心理念,就是将内容缓存在终端用户附近。
CDN(Content Delivery Network)是指内容分发网络,也称为内容传送网络,这个概念始于1996年,是美国麻省理工学院的一个研究小组为改善互联网的服务质量而提出的。
CDN,是地理上分布的网络的代理服务器和它们的数据中心。